The power of gratitude in enhancing mental wellbeing

Brian Omondi by Brian Omondi
June 7, 2024
in Features
Reading Time: 2 mins read

Gratitude is the quality of being grateful for what is valuable and meaningful to oneself, whether tangible or intangible. It involves recognizing the good things in our lives and appreciating every little one. Embracing gratitude amidst challenges is not about ignoring the challenges but about acknowledging the positive aspects of our lives, which can be a source of strength during hardships. 

We live in a world where contentment is very rare. Everyone seems to be looking for something better without showing appreciation for what we have. Even during hardships, it is important to remind yourself of the little positive things in your life. 

Mark Manson wrote that, “The desire for more positive experience is itself a negative experience. And, paradoxically, the acceptance of one’s negative experience is itself a positive experience.” This simply means that we should shift our focus from trying to escape negative experiences and focus on the positive amidst the negative situation. Some of the benefits of embracing gratitude are outlined below. 

  • Improved mental wellbeing

Gratitude shifts our focus from what we lack to what we have. Being consumed in negative thoughts can be detrimental to our mental health. Research by the Alzheimer’s Association found that repetitive negative thinking is linked to cognitive decline. Although it is important to feel and express negative emotions, we should not be so caught up in the negativity that we are blinded from the positive things in life.

  • Strengthened relationships 

Showing gratitude for the people in our lives is a great way to improve the bonds we have with them. Gratitude to loved ones can range from saying thank you for their actions, showing up for them, or gift giving. 

  • Growth mindset 

Gratitude encourages a growth mindset by helping us see challenges as opportunities for growth and learning.  It shifts our focus from what we cannot control to what we can influence and improve. 

  • Resilience 

Gratitude keeps us resilient during difficulties. This is because your ability to cope with difficulties is improved when your focus is on the positive aspects of the situation. Making it through challenges also builds confidence in one’s ability. 

Gratitude is a mindset that often requires practice to master. It is important to be patient with yourself when going through challenges.
